18. Transparency in Distributed Systems
·Distributed systems should be perceived by users and application programmers as a wholerather
than as a collection of cooperating components.
·Transparency has different dimensions.
These represent various properties that distributed systems should have.
Access Transparency
·Enables local and remote information objects to be accessed using identical operations.
·Example:SQL Queries
Location Transparency
·Enables information objects to be accessed without knowledge of their location.
·Example:Pages in the Web
·Example:Tables in distributed databases
